The collection reflects a diverse spectrum of medical cultures and concerns in India.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e anthology touches upon themes such as medical pluralism, patient care, the individual and social crises during epidemics, medical ethics, medical paternalism, disease-mongering, and medicalization, alongside issues of women’s mental and physical health, including pregnancy, childbirth, abortion, and depression. Through these stories, readers are introduced to both modern medical professionals like doctors, nurses, and surgeons, as well as traditional healers such as vaids, hakims, kavirajs, quacks, and folk healers.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e stories range from the early 20th century to contemporary works, featuring renowned authors such as Rabindranath Tagore, Premchand, and Saadat Hasan Manto, alongside medical practitioners like Rashid Jahan and Shirin Shrikant Valavade. Modern writers such as Annie Zaidi and Jeelani Bano also contribute to this rich collection.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This anthology provides fresh insights into the intersection of literature and medicine, offering readers a deeper understanding of medical concerns, societal challenges, and the evolving nature of healthcare in India.
